The Fifty Something Tour is an upcoming concert tour by the Canadian rock band Rush The tour is set to begin on June 7, 2026 in Inglewood, California and is set to conclude in Vancouver, British Columbia on December 17, 2026, [1] although the band has discussed the possibility of extending the tour into 2027 [2]
